Highlights

  • National Exit Test (NExT) is a combined single-window exam for MBBS students to qualify for admission into postgraduate courses as well as to obtain the license to practice medicine in India. The exam is to be held in two steps to check theoretical and practical knowledge of candidates. Once implemented, NExT will replace multiple exams including NEET PG and FMGE.

I am absolutely satisfied with our college due to teachers, studies, infrastructure and everything.
Placements: Students who have good NEET rank got placed from our course. We can work in any hospital, but mostly we are offered to get a PG after MBBS in our college. The lowest salary of Rs. 25,000 per month and the highest salary of up to Rs. 70,000 per month are offered for MBBS graduates. Almost all students get jobs after completing MBBS.
Infrastructure: The food served is good, but we don't have non-vegetarian food. The canteen is not that great, but you can have basics things. Sports and games are encouraged to a limit. Our college had a library and study rooms, which are good enough. Seminar halls, demo rooms, labs and everything are fine. First-year students will get 4 cadavers for dissection.
Faculty: Our college has good patient exposure, and even in departments like psychiatry. I am satisfied with teaching faculty members in our college. Teachers are good in both teaching as well as guiding us for a better future. Our college can surely produce good doctors. Students who have a passion for medical sciences can surely choose our college. Regarding education, our college is one of the finest colleges in Andhra Pradesh.
Other: I like MBBS, so I chose this course. Events, fests and extracurricular activities are organised, which are great stress busters. Fee reimbursement is provided, and the scholarship of Rs. 3,000 per year is provided by the government.

It is a great college with good infrastructure and atmosphere. The faculty is experienced.
Placements: There are 200 students in each batch and around 1,000 medicos in the college. MBBS courses are provided. Post-graduation courses are provided. There is a scope to do research. A free internship for one year is provided with an appropriate salary for everyone studying there. 100 percent of students get internships in college.
Infrastructure: Classrooms are equipped with air-conditioners, projectors, chalkboards, and comfortable seating. There are speakers around the classroom for better hearing. Rooms in the hostel are nearby and well-maintained. We get good food. It is well-maintained and equipped. Proper cleaning is done here. Rooms are cleaned every day.
Faculty: Our college has excellent and well-experienced faculty members. Semester exams are good. The course curriculum is very important and very relevant. It makes students industry-ready. The pass percentage of my batch in the first year was 97 percent, which is the highest in my state. There are excellent professors. They are always available.
Other: I always wanted to become a doctor, so I chose it. The best thing about my course is that I am able to meet various people, hear various stories, and help them get better.
